Sunsoft has announced that Leiji Matsumoto ’s newest manga, Out of Galaxy Koshika , will debut on the Nintendo Wii’s Shopping Channel on April 14th. Sorry, all, Japan only, at least for now. Sunsoft already released Princess Ai in January. Unlike Princess Ai , however, this is a totally new manga title. The first episode will cost 500 Wii points ($5).
